Land owners and caretakers have also created mutually beneficial agreements where one person develops the land, the other pays the bills. We’ve seen these arrangements work very well, or terribly. Agreements in writing make all the difference between success and failure in these arrangements. 

We can’t emphasize enough how important it is to take the time to make clear agreements that all sides see as beneficial to themselves and put them in writing rather than depend on people’s memories. By ensuring the agreements are legally binding, you further protect all parties. 

Cultivate Farms is an online platform that is endeavoring to try to match retiring farmers with young people who can take over the farms. This is a significant situation in the US right now with most farmers aged 50 or more.
